
Christen Sewell
Professional Bio
Christen Sewell counsels private and public companies and executives on all aspects of employee benefits and executive compensation.
Christen has a particular focus on benefits issues for start-ups and emerging growth companies, including:
- Advising on the design, compliance, and administration of stock options and equity-based plans and arrangements.
- Drafting and negotiating executive compensation arrangements, including, employment, retention, change in control, and separation agreements.
Christen also advises clients on:
- Tax-qualified retirement plans
- Health and welfare plans
- Non-qualified deferred compensation arrangements
- Bonus and incentive plans
- Corporate transactions (M&A, joint ventures, financings, spin-offs, public offerings, SPACs)
Christen’s expertise covers:
- Code Section 409A deferred compensation rules
- Tax rules governing equity compensation
- Golden parachute rules under Code Section 280G
- ERISA
- COBRA
- PPACA
- GINA
- HIPAA
